An intriguing novel about the extremes some liberal elements in this country and the world are willing to engage in. Over the top? Maybe but not so far-fetched as it sounds especially given the current headlines.

This book is a thriller. In the not so distant future the EPA is the strong arm of Federal Law Enforcement. Yeah, I kid you not.....given how outrageous some of their actions are today maybe not so far fetched eh?

A global dictator is all set to come to power. An intern for the EPA uncovers a conspiracy which will blow the environmentalists and the reason for giving the EPA unlimited powers out of the water.

Global warming........what if it all was a hoax invented to cover up something else? Something that was NOT caused by global warming and the greenhouse effect but something that was caused by man?

Enter a secret nuclear testing project code named "Thor". The young EPA agent discovers the cover up but soon is murdered but not before turning over all the documentation to his supervisor who does not want to be involved but realizes his responsibility is to tell the world about this conspiracy. Only problem is that he might not stay alive long enough to use the documentation and piece together events in time to make a difference.

It's a fast paced thrill ride. I'd recommend it.
